I would like to restrict all extensions from dialing 411 and 1411. Would using a disallow list work or would ARS be a better fix. I see where using a disallow list you must assign the extensions to the list. But I am not sure how to use ARS to restrict the 1411 and 411 calls. I have heard where people have directed those calls to pools with no trunks but I am unsure how to program it.
 
The ARS table used for 411 & 1411 is the same as for 911, so that's not a very good option.

I consider the DISALLOW and DISALLOW TO as the way to go in getting this done.

A DISALLOW LIST can be created with those 2 entries, and then you assign it to all phones you do not want to dial those numbers (DISALLOW TO).

It's pretty straight forward, but if you have any problems, re-post.




 
Thank you. The disallow list did work. I wasn't sure if ARS would override the disallow list.
